JanKoWeb: Open source - VirtualBox a BASH: mount a cp

VirtualBox a BASH: mount a cp

Jak jsem psal v článku http://jankoweb.moxo.cz/blog/open-source/svn-error-the-server-sent-an-improper-http-response-pri-commitu/, potíže s SVN mě donutily nainstalovat ve VirtualBoxu Lubuntu 13, ve kterém je ještě staré dobré subversion verze 1.7.x.

Po instalaci jsem nainstaloval jeste grafické rozhraní:

sudo add-apt-repository ppa:rabbitvcs/ppa
sudo apt-get update
sudo apt-get install rabbitvcs-cli
sudo apt-get install rabbitvcs-nautilus3

Potom prohlížeč souborů pouštím příkazem "nautilus" a krásně vidím, co je v svn aktuální a co ne.

Pro připojení složky do VirtualBoxu (musí být nastavena jako "share" v Zařízení/Sdílené složky - a musí být doinstalovaná potvora pro podporu - ono to začne křičet):

sudo mount -t vboxsf share /media/ProjektSVN
cp /media/ProjektSVN/* ~/Dokumenty/ProjektSVN/
cd ~/Dokumenty/ProjektSVN

Pokud máme ve složce ProjektSVN skryté adresáře, hvězdička způsobí, že ty nebudou kopírovány.

Nebo pro kopírování složitější adresářové struktury:

sudo mount -t vboxsf share /media/ProjektSVN
rsync -av --exclude=".*" /media/ProjektSVN/ ~/Dokumenty/
cd ~/Dokumenty/ProjektSVN
Rubrika Open source | Tagy Bash, Virtual box | St 08.10.2014 | 710x

Náhodné články

Tento web jsem zakládal na střední, v roce 2008. Je zde hlavně archiv mé tvorby.

Aktuální věci publikuji kvůli úspoře času na Twitter.

Honza

"K tomu, abychom mohli empatii dávat, potřebujeme ji sami dostávat."

M. Rosenberg